👩‍🍳 How to make Chemeen Roast

  1. Marinate prawns (10 mins): Mix cleaned prawns with 2 tbsp ginger-garlic paste, 1/2 tbsp Kashmiri chili powder, 1/4 tsp turmeric, salt, and 1 tbsp lime juice. Set aside.
  2. Brown onions (4 mins, medium-high heat): Heat coconut oil in wide pan. Add sliced onions and fry for 3-4 minutes until golden and edges begin to brown slightly.
  3. Build masala (3 mins, medium heat): Add remaining ginger-garlic paste to onions, cook for 1 minute. Add remaining Kashmiri chili powder, coriander powder, black pepper powder, fennel powder. Stir for 2 minutes; oil should separate.
  4. Caramelize (3 mins, medium-low heat): Continue cooking, stirring occasionally, until prawns develop slight charred spots and masala clings to them. Do not overcook or prawns become rubbery.
  5. Finish (1 min, low heat): Turn off heat immediately. Drizzle remaining lime juice. Prawns should be moist but not soupy.

📖 Cultural notes

Chemeen Roast is a quintessential Kerala seafood appetizer served at celebrations, balancing spice intensity with the delicate sweetness of large prawns. ---
